CVE-2026-33471

nimiq-block contains block primitives to be used in Nimiq's Rust implementation. "SkipBlockProof::verify" computes its quorum check using "BitSet.len()", then iterates "BitSet" indices and casts each "usize" index to "u16" ("slot as u16") for slot lookup. Prior to version 1.3.0, if an attacker can get a "SkipBlockProof" verified where "MultiSignature.signers" contains out-of-range indices spaced by 65536, these indices inflate "len()" but collide onto the same in-range "u16" slot during aggregation. This makes it possible for a malicious validator with far fewer than "2f+1" real signer slots to pass skip block proof verification by multiplying a single BLS signature by the same factor. The patch for this vulnerability is included as part of v1.3.0. No known workarounds are available.
Affected Packages
nimiq-block (RUST):
Affected version(s) >=0.0.0 <1.3.0Fix Suggestion:
Update to version 1.3.0Related Resources (6)
